Fardeen Khan shares insights on battling depression: 'It's a natural process'

Fardeen Khan has shared his experiences with depression and the challenges he has faced.

In an interview with Pinkvilla, the 50-year-old actor described depression as "a natural process everyone goes through."

He also emphasized the importance of protecting oneself from constantly "wanting to be happy," and mentioned that there are times when he retreats "into a shell" and spends time "just sitting and thinking about things."

The No Entry actor said "sometimes you slip into depression, you don’t feel positive, things don’t have meaning or purpose but in my experience that is a way you find yourself."

"I think the treasure lies in that deep dark cave. It’s a constant cycle of death and resurrection. Of course, some days are tough. I sometimes go into a shell. I like to just sit and think about things."

"People who know me sometimes say I overthink but when I am down I kind of sit and ponder about it for a few days to figure out why exactly I am feeling down. Once I find that, it’s much less challenging to get back to being normal," he added.

Fardeen also explained that depression is a natural process indicating unfulfilled aspects of life. "It’s a natural process everyone goes through."

Urging people to guard against the constant desire for happiness and recognize misalignments within themselves, the actor shared, "We have to safeguard ourselves from this desire to always want to be happy."

"If there are things that are depressing you, it is actually a signal for you to think about something that is unfulfilled in your life. There’s something that you are not aligned with, there’s something not in sync."

Fardeen was last seen in Sanjay Leela Bhansali's web-series Heeramandi, released on May 1, 2024.
